ASTRO: IC 2574
This is a member of the M81 group. A very faint member. Even at 80
minutes this was a rather noisy image. I needed more color and had been waiting to get it but the skies had other ideas. It is now into my Polaris tree. At its declination I can get it only well east of the meridian when it clears the east side of the tree. At about 3 hours from the meridian it enters the tree and stays there the rest of the year. So I have a short window on this one. Maybe next year. I had figured the bright blue arcs were HII bubbles, apparently not as they were quite weak in red light and strong in blue. Not sure what to make of that. Must be bubbles of hot new stars rather than gas clouds. Next time maybe some H alpha data is in order. 14" LX200R @ f/10, L=8x10' RGB=2x10' binned 3x3, STL-11000XM, Paramount ME Rick -- Correct domain name is arvig and it is net not com.
